The Xiaomi Black Shark 3 Pro has a general score of 90.1, which is a bit better than Motorola Edge 50 Neo's 81.9 score. The Xiaomi Black Shark 3 Pro is a noticeably older, extremely thicker and a lot heavier cellphone than Motorola Edge 50 Neo. Both phones we compare here have Android OS (Operating System), but Xiaomi Black Shark 3 Pro has 10 version while Motorola Edge 50 Neo has Android 14.
Xiaomi Black Shark 3 Pro features an extremely better processor than Motorola Edge 50 Neo. Both have a 8 GB RAM memory and the same number of cores. The Motorola Edge 50 Neo has a sharper display than Xiaomi Black Shark 3 Pro, although it has a little lower resolution of 1256 x 2760, a just a bit inferior pixels count in each inch of display and a little smaller display.
The Motorola Edge 50 Neo and the Xiaomi Black Shark 3 Pro have very similar storage for games and applications, both of them have exactly the same internal memory. The Xiaomi Black Shark 3 Pro features better battery lifetime than Motorola Edge 50 Neo, because it has 5000mAh of battery capacity. Xiaomi Black Shark 3 Pro counts with a little bit better camera than Motorola Edge 50 Neo, because although it has a tinier back-facing camera sensor which gives a lower photo and video quality, and they both have the same (4K) video resolution and a same size aperture, the Xiaomi Black Shark 3 Pro also counts with higher video frame rates and a lot higher 64 mega pixels resolution back facing camera.
